[N168] Julius was always active in politics and had once been engaged in coal mining, and was the superintendent in coal for a number of years. Upon taking office, in Jan 1938, he appointed the following deputies: Wiley Hall and Harry B. Adams, Paintsville; Elijah Standiford and Marion Collins of Williamsport; Joe wells, Odds; Alex Pelphrey, Van Lear; Jess Vanhoose, Barnetts Creek; Ray Bayes, Staffordsville; and D.P. Castle, Nippa.
